What Are Vivant Skin Care Products?
Vivant Skin Care has been in the game for over 40 years, crafting products rooted in research. Their lineup tackles common skin concerns with ingredients like mandelic acid, benzoyl peroxide, and peptides. Whether you’re dealing with stubborn breakouts or fine lines, they’ve got something designed to help. What I love is their step-by-step system—products are marked with dots to guide you through your routine, making it super easy to follow.
Their range includes cleansers, toners, serums, and moisturizers, each formulated to work together. For example, Vivant Skin Care Totaloe is a calming gel that soothes irritation, while their Allantoin Sedating Hydrating Lotion locks in moisture without clogging pores. It’s practical, no-fuss skincare that feels professional yet approachable.

How Much Do Vivant Skin Care Products Cost?
Let’s talk Vivant skin care products price. These aren’t drugstore cheap, but they’re not La Mer-level either. A 4 oz cleanser, like the BP 3% Exfoliating Cleanser, runs about $30-$35. Serums, like the 8% Mandelic Acid, are closer to $70 for 1 oz. Moisturizers, including the Allantoin lotion, hover around $40-$50. If you’re building a full routine, expect to spend $150-$200 upfront.
Here’s a tip: keep an eye out for a Vivant Skin Care discount code. They pop up occasionally on their website or through spa partners, sometimes knocking 10-20% off. It’s not a steal, but it helps. Compared to similar professional brands, Vivant’s pricing feels fair for the quality.
Why Choose Vivant Skin Care Professional Products?
Vivant Skin Care professional products are a big part of their appeal. They’re designed with higher concentrations of active ingredients, which is why you’ll often find them at med spas or dermatologist offices. Think of it like the difference between a regular coffee and an espresso shot—more potency in every drop. Their mandelic acid line, for instance, is tailored for sensitive or melanin-rich skin, reducing irritation while tackling pigmentation.
I’ve noticed Vivant emphasizes education, too. Their website and packaging explain how to layer products and ease into actives to avoid irritation. It’s like having a mini skincare coach, which is great if you’re new to clinical-grade stuff.
Spotlight on Vivant Skin Care Totaloe
Let’s zoom in on Vivant Skin Care Totaloe. This gel is a gem for calming redness or post-treatment skin. It’s packed with aloe vera and algae to hydrate and soothe without feeling heavy. People with acne or rosacea seem to love it for keeping flare-ups in check. I’ve read reviews where users apply it twice daily, and it helps fade red marks over time.
It’s not a miracle worker—don’t expect overnight magic—but it’s a solid addition if your skin gets cranky. At around $45 for 3 oz, it’s priced decently for a targeted product. Plus, it pairs well with their serums for a balanced routine.
Vivant Skin Care Allantoin: The Soothing Star
Another standout is Vivant skin care Allantoin. Allantoin is an ingredient known for its calming and healing properties, and Vivant’s Sedating Hydrating Lotion uses it to great effect. It’s lightweight, non-greasy, and perfect for sensitive skin or after exfoliating treatments. I’ve seen it praised for reducing dryness without causing breakouts, which is a tricky balance.
At about $40 for 3 oz, it’s a practical choice for daily hydration. If your skin feels tight or irritated, this could be a game-changer. It’s not flashy, but it gets the job done quietly and effectively.

FAQ’s
Is Vivant skincare medical grade?
Vivant’s products are considered professional-grade, often sold through dermatologists or spas. They use higher concentrations of active ingredients like mandelic acid, but “medical grade” isn’t a regulated term. Think of them as clinical-strength, not prescription-level.
Which is the best brand for skincare?
It depends on your needs! Vivant’s great for acne and pigmentation, especially for sensitive or melanin-rich skin. Other solid brands include SkinCeuticals for anti-aging or CeraVe for budget-friendly basics. Your skin type and goals decide what’s “best.”
Who is the founder of Vivant skincare?
Vivant was founded by Dr. James E. Fulton, a dermatologist who co-developed Retin-A, and his wife, Sara Fulton. Their work focused on science-driven solutions for acne and aging, shaping Vivant’s formula-first approach.
